The Nutrition Educator provides nutrition education classes throughout the HFB service area to partner agencies, community partners, schools, churches, transitional living facilities, clinics, and in collaboration with other organizations both in-person and virtually online. Teaches nutrition classes using curriculum provided by the nutrition education department based on MyPlate, in compliance with SNAP-Ed guidelines, and other science- and evidence-based programs, coordinating with other staff and supervising dietetic interns or volunteers as needed. Aids in cultivating community partnerships. Keeps supervisor well informed of area activities and projects.
